Understanding the Concept of a Tandem Alternative
Language tandem learning typically involves two individuals who are native speakers of different languages teaching each other in a reciprocal exchange. However, not all tandem platforms offer the same experience, and some learners may seek a tandem alternative that better suits their preferences, schedule, or learning goals.
A tandem alternative usually refers to platforms or methods that replicate or improve upon the traditional tandem language exchange format, often integrating features like:
- Structured lesson plans
- Professional tutor access
- AI-based language correction
- Community-driven practice groups
- Flexible communication modes (text, audio, video)
By exploring these alternatives, learners can find more tailored and efficient ways to practice a new language.
Why Consider a Tandem Alternative?
While tandem learning has many benefits, it also presents challenges such as inconsistent partner availability, varying commitment levels, and potential language imbalances. Here are some reasons why a tandem alternative might be more advantageous:
1. Consistent Learning Environment
Traditional tandem exchanges rely heavily on finding and maintaining a committed language partner. A tandem alternative often provides a more structured schedule and reliable interaction, ensuring learners can practice regularly.
2. Professional Guidance
Many tandem alternatives include access to qualified language tutors or AI-powered feedback, which can accelerate learning by addressing grammar mistakes, pronunciation, and vocabulary usage more effectively than peer exchanges.
3. Diverse Learning Resources
Beyond conversational practice, tandem alternatives frequently offer integrated learning materials, quizzes, and cultural content, enriching the language acquisition process.
4. Flexibility and Accessibility
With multiple communication formats and asynchronous learning options, tandem alternatives accommodate busy schedules and different time zones, making language practice more flexible.

How to Maximize Your Experience with a Tandem Alternative
To get the most out of any tandem alternative, consider the following strategies:
- Set Clear Goals: Define what you want to achieve, whether it’s conversational fluency, grammar mastery, or vocabulary expansion.
- Maintain Consistency: Schedule regular sessions and practice daily, even if only for short periods.
- Engage Actively: Participate in community discussions, ask questions, and provide feedback to peers.
- Utilize All Features: Take advantage of learning materials, AI tools, and cultural resources offered by the platform.
- Track Progress: Use built-in analytics or journaling to monitor improvements and identify areas needing attention.
